Proverbs 9:10 NKJV

“The fear of the Lord is the beginning of wisdom, And the knowledge of the Holy One is understanding.”

INSIGHT

-Understand in Hebrew is written as Sakal which means to give attention, be prudent, act wisely and ponder upon a matter. Understanding is a Spirit that originates from the Holy Spirit. Isaiah 11:2 says that, “The Spirit of the Lord will rest on him— the Spirit of wisdom and of understanding, the Spirit of counsel and of might, the Spirit of the knowledge and fear of the Lord.” Jesus operated under the enablement of the Holy Spirit when He became flesh and dwelt among us. We also note that wisdom proceeds from the fear of the Lord and the knowledge of God, understanding. James 3:13 ask, “Who is wise and understanding among you? Let them show it by their good life, by deeds done in the humility that comes from wisdom.” We note that humility and the fear of the Lord are inseparable and when put into practice they develop us in wisdom. We get understanding from the Holy Spirit who guides us as we reading and study the Word of God, pray and fellowship with other brethren. The Holy Spirit helps us to establish and cultivate a relationship with Him as He reveals His divine purpose for our lives.

Proverbs‬ ‭14‬:‭29‬ ‭NIV‬‬‬‬‬

“Whoever is patient has great understanding, but one who is quick-tempered displays folly.”

INSIGHT
-One who has a short temper often gets into trouble, and ensnares those around him. The Bible warns against making friends with hot-tempered people, or associating with those who are easily angered, for you may learn their ways and get yourself ensnared (Proverbs‬ ‭22‬:‭24‬-‭25‬). When Dinah was raped by Shechem son of Hamor the Hivite, his brothers Simeon and Levi, who were short tempered did not wait for their fathers decree on the matter and acted outrageously. They killed all the men in Shechem and this exposed their father Jacob to his neighbors, the Canaanites and Perizzites (Genesis‬ ‭34‬:‭1-30). When their brothers received a blessing from their father, a curse was pronounced upon them as indicated in Genesis‬ ‭49‬:‭5‬-‭7‬ saying, “Simeon and Levi are brothers their swords are weapons of violence. Let me not enter their council, let me not join their assembly, for they have killed men in their anger and hamstrung oxen as they pleased. Cursed be their anger, so fierce, and their fury, so cruel! I will scatter them in Jacob and disperse them in Israel.” When we receive patience; a fruit of the Holy Spirit, we obtain understanding and are able to tame our anger and remain calm as we wait on God’s guidance.

Proverbs 11:12 NIV

“Whoever derides their neighbor has no sense, but the one who has understanding holds their tongue.”

INSIGHT

-The way of wisdom is the pathway of love and respect. When one despises or ridicules his neighbor, it is not evidence of superior wisdom and discernment, but lack of understanding. Proverbs 10:19 discloses that, “In the multitude of words sin is not lacking, But he who restrains his lips is wise.” Men and women of understanding recognize there is a time and place to hold back one’s tongue and desist from any form of outrage. They know when love and respect should compel them to hold their peace. God’s gives us understanding to enable us guard our lips and therefore acquire a preservation of life and avoid destruction by His grace (Proverbs 13:3).

Acts 8:26-31 NKJV

“Now an angel of the Lord spoke to Philip, saying, “Arise and go toward the south along the road which goes down from Jerusalem to Gaza.” This is desert. So he arose and went. And behold, a man of Ethiopia, a eunuch of great authority under Candace the queen of the Ethiopians, who had charge of all her treasury, and had come to Jerusalem to worship, was returning. And sitting in his chariot, he was reading Isaiah the prophet. Then the Spirit said to Philip, “Go near and overtake this chariot.” So Philip ran to him, and heard him reading the prophet Isaiah, and said, “Do you understand what you are reading?” And he said, “How can I, unless someone guides me?” And he asked Philip to come up and sit with him.”

INSIGHT

-The spirit of understanding instills in us the comprehension of deep things of the Word of God and His kingdom. When the Ethiopian eunuch could not understand the text that he was reading, the Lord send Philip to break down the gospel of truth to him. Like the eunuch, we are limited by the knowledge or reality that we are taught or exposed to. Apollos had been instructed in the way of the Lord, and he spoke with great fervor and taught about Jesus accurately, though he knew only the baptism of John (Acts 18:25). Jesus in Luke 24:45, opened the minds of His disciples so they could understand the Scriptures. Let us continually ask Jesus to open the minds of our understanding, that we may know Him more and seek first His kingdom and His righteousness.

SUMMARY

Understanding is a critical component of comprehending truths in the kingdom of God. The Lord is the author of understanding. Ecclesiastes 11:5 says that, “As you do not know the path of the wind, or how the body is formed in a mother’s womb, so you cannot understand the work of God, the Maker of all things.” Understanding is knowing God and submitting to His wisdom and strength (Jeremiah 9:23-24). Understanding is knowing when to speak, and what to say. Understanding is to holds one’s tongue and not talking uncontrollably (Proverbs 11:12). When one is angry they tend to talk especially evil words. The Bible in Ephesians 4:26 reminds us that even when we get angry we should not sin. One way we can sin is pronouncing vulgar, cursing, deceitful, oppressive and abusive words (Psalms 10:7). The tongue has the power of life and death, and those who love it will eat its fruit (Proverbs 18:21). Understanding exercises patience but one who is quick-tempered displays folly (Proverbs 14:29). Whoever guards his mouth and tongue Keeps his soul from troubles (Proverbs 21:23). Understanding is keeping calm in humility and the fear of the Lord (Proverbs 9:10). Wisdom is fruitless unless we have the spirit of understanding. Proverbs 4:7 notes that, “The beginning of wisdom is this: Get wisdom. Though it cost all you have, get understanding.” God gives one the spirit of understanding as He wills. He gave king Solomon a wise and understanding heart, so that there has not been anyone like him before, nor shall any like him arise afterwards (1 Kings 3:12). The fruit of peace given by the Holy Spirit of God perplexes the understanding of men and guards our hearts and minds in Christ Jesus. Understanding can be good. Good understanding leads us to gain favor from God, but the way of the unfaithful is difficult (Proverbs 13:15).
